Overview of Alma College

Alma College, located in the small town of Alma, Michigan, is a private liberal arts college founded in 1886. Nestled in the heart of the United States, this institution has built a reputation for providing a personalized education to its approximately 1,200 undergraduate students. Known for its strong sense of community and commitment to student success, Alma College offers a range of academic programs across disciplines like business, education, health professions, sciences, and the arts. For those seeking jobs at Alma College, the institution stands out as an employer that values teaching excellence, undergraduate research, and faculty-student collaboration.

The college's campus spans 142 acres, featuring modern facilities alongside historic buildings, creating an inviting environment for employees. Alma College emphasizes experiential learning through initiatives like the Alma Experience, which integrates internships, study abroad, and service learning into the curriculum. This approach not only benefits students but also provides faculty and staff with dynamic opportunities to engage in innovative teaching and mentoring.

History of Alma College

Established by the Presbyterian Church, Alma College began as a coeducational institution during a time when many colleges were single-sex. Over the decades, it evolved from a junior college to a four-year baccalaureate institution in 1930. Key milestones include the expansion of its science programs in the mid-20th century and the introduction of graduate programs in recent years, such as occupational therapy. Diversity and Inclusion Initiatives at Alma College

Alma College prioritizes diversity through its Strategic Plan for Inclusive Excellence, aiming for a representative faculty and staff. Initiatives include bias training, affinity groups for underrepresented employees, and partnerships with Posse and McNair Scholars. The college tracks hiring diversity metrics and offers support for underrepresented candidates, such as travel reimbursements for interviews. Recent hires reflect commitment to gender balance and ethnic diversity in STEM fields.

Work-Life Balance and Campus Life

Alma College fosters work-life balance with generous PTO, family leave, and wellness programs including gym access and counseling. Faculty benefit from sabbaticals every seven years and professional development funds. Campus life features events like Fall Arts and family-friendly activities, with Alma's safe, small-town setting (population ~9,000) offering low cost of living and proximity to larger cities like Lansing (1 hour away).

Employees praise the collaborative culture, low student-faculty ratio (13:1), and perks like tuition remission for dependents. Seasonal events, athletic support, and community engagement enhance daily life.
